Hellbound, for
murder
Whose murder? my child's
she who raised herself,
lost
her childhood, long ago
because of me, I wasn't there
she
needed my love
She was raped, I never knew
She snuck out but
never told
She smoked, she drank
she had a child
never a
word she said
Now she's gone and so am I
in her room, where she
lived
I died
Hellbound, for murder
Whose murder? my
child's
For as with words may
keep alive
In silence may you
kill
